Soto bags Pacquiao's former WBC super feather belt

"La Zorrita" Humbeto Soto claimed the World Boxing Council's interim super featherweight championship via a 10th round technical knockout of Gamaliel "Platano" Diaz Saturday night in Coahuila de Zaragoza, Mexico.

Fightnews.com reported that Soto decked Diaz once in round one.

Referee Lawrence Cole, meanwhile, subtracted two points against Diaz for continuous holding.

As round 10 ended, Diaz's corner decided to keep him in his corner as his coach decided against sending him out for the 11th round.

The win improved Soto's record to 45-7-2 with 28 knockout wins while Diaz dropped to 23-87-2 with 10 KOs.

The fight for the WBC interim super featherweight title was the same battle that Soto fought for in June when he was disqualified against Francisco Lorenzo.

In a WBC super featherweight eliminator match, Humberto "Betillo" Gutiérrez (23-1-1, 18 KOs) won a 10-round unanimous decision over Guadalupe "Bronco" Rosales (27-2, 15 KOs).

Incidentally, Soto's new belt was once worn by Filipino ring idol Manny Pacquiao. He win it via TKO against Mexico's Hector Velasquez in 2005.
